Remote Desktop Connection
Hello.
I am using a Mac Book Pro, OSX 10.8.3 Running Remote Desktop Connection 2.1.1 I am trying to connect to my Windows 7 Pro machine at home from work. When I clicked connect - it just spins - trying to connect and never connects. Eventually, it seems like it kinda locks up because I can't click cancel or close it out - and I have to force quit the application. I am running a virtual windows 7 as well, and I can RDP home with no issues from that machine. Another side note - is when I am at home - the RDC works to my home PC with no issues |
